Cranial Nerve Examination Insights

This chapter explores the neurological examination of a patient with ptosis and restricted eye movements, indicating potential cranial nerve pathology. It covers differential diagnoses, anatomical considerations of cranial nerves in the cavernous sinus, and the complexities involved in diagnosing nerve involvement.
